Weismann Co. issued 13-year bonds a year ago at a coupon rate of 11 percent. The bonds make semiannual payments and have a par v
Elis [28]

Answer:

$1,423.39

Explanation:

For computing the current bond price we use the present value formula i.e to be shown in the attachment below:

Given that,  

Future value = $1,000

Rate of interest = 6%  ÷ 2 = 3%

NPER = 13 years  - 1 year = 12 years × 2 = 24 years

PMT = $1,000 × 11% ÷ 2 = $55

The formula is shown below:

= -PV(Rate;NPER;PMT;FV;type)

After applying the above formula, the current bond price is $1,423.39

Firms often seek to borrow money to expand their capital stock, and the price they pay for the money is the interest rate. What
True [87]

Answer:

When interest rate rises, the quantity of money demanded reduces

Explanation:

As interest rate increases firms seeking to borrow money for capital stock expansion are likely not going to go ahead with it. The reason is simply because, interest rate and money demanded have an inverse relationship. As interest rate rises money demanded falls because it means that for any amount of money borrowed the interest rate attached to it is higher making the cost of borrowing heavier on the borrower.
